Summary

This article from a 1972 special issue of L'Architecture d'Aujourd'hui documents 'Maison Taminiaux' in Brussels (1928). The text attributes the design to Henri Baudoux, a mosaic contractor, while noting the stylistic influence of architect M. Brunnenstein. The house, built for A. Vesselle, is recognized in the Lydia Kümel archives as the Brunnenstein house (or Maison Venelle). The publication includes extensive photographic documentation of the exterior and interior, along with architectural plans.
